Output 0737042160abcb3da9c77ef20e669f985168eb197b39c2244db59fbcc25e3e8e:0

value
1465814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7abf4d2ba3d2a15c449ace6514a99e0211af165 OP_EQUAL
address
3QGapfLkQ8g5fuX1Y4hVtskZg5j3zS1J6i
transaction
0737042160abcb3da9c77ef20e669f985168eb197b39c2244db59fbcc25e3e8e
spent
true